Social media marketing helps earn and nurture loyal customers.
Capturing your ideal customers’ attention on the platforms where they spend the most time is one of the best ways to increase your visibility, turn prospects into qualified leads and convert leads into loyal customers. And if you can encourage your followers and target audience to share your content, you’ve just increased your reach tremendously. Social media can also help you better retain and cross-sell to your existing customer base for a boost to your bottom line. Consider that:
- Seventy-four percent of social media users visit Facebook daily. Sixty percent visit Instagram every day, and 46 percent are on Twitter daily.
- 50 percent of millennials research products on the internet before they buy.
- Seven in 10 Gen Xers will purchase something from a brand they follow on social media
